Innovations in Glass: Beyond Standard Options
The glass industry has evolved far beyond basic panes and simple shapes. Today’s innovations include smart glass that changes opacity with the touch of a button, energy-efficient glazing that reduces heat loss, and laminated safety glass that offers enhanced protection. Decorative options such as digital printing, sandblasting, and fused glass techniques open up endless possibilities for creative expression. These advancements empower you to push the boundaries of design, functionality, and sustainability in any project.

Safety and Durability: Glass Selection Guide
Choosing the right glass is crucial for safety and longevity. Tempered and laminated glass are engineered for strength, making them ideal for high-traffic areas and structural applications. For added security, consider impact-resistant or bulletproof glass. It’s important to work with experienced professionals who understand building codes and can recommend the best all glass options for your needs, ensuring peace of mind without sacrificing style.
